What is the B2 Zertifikat?
The B2 Zertifikat is a language proficiency test that assesses a candidate's ability to use German in a professional context. It is part of the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R) and corresponds to the B2 level, which indicates an upper-intermediate level of proficiency. At this level, individuals can:



Understand the main ideas of complex text on both concrete and abstract topics.

Interact with a degree of fluency and spontaneity that makes regular interaction with native speakers quite possible.

Produce clear, detailed text on a wide range of subjects and explain a viewpoint on a topical issue.


Why is the B2 Zertifikat Important?

Professional Advancement
For professionals, the B2 Zertifikat is often a requirement for employment in German-speaking countries. It demonstrates to employers that the candidate has the necessary language skills to communicate effectively in the workplace, understand complex instructions, and participate in meetings and presentations.


Academic Opportunities
For students and researchers, the B2 Zertifikat is frequently required for admission to universities and other educational institutions in Germany, Austria, and Switzerland.
